My dearest Son. I have undertaken to write in the room of one of Your Sister who are employed in sitting for their Pictures the whole Morning by which means they are prevented to save the Post.

I will begin with informing You that I have received from Lady Newhaven the two Papers concerning deletion unclear /deletion the Orders & regulations of Your Nursery, & as Sr Henry is desirous of having them returned, Elyzabeth is to Copy them, & at Your return You may compare Hers with the Originals & Nothing can be better than they are & if following Strictly all must go on well. _ I have also mentioned to the King that lady Ewston had opplied to You to succeed lady Willoughby, & that You had refused it. He made no Answer, & I believe is quite indifferent about Her.
